Abstract

The present invention provides an inter-system measurement information transmission method and system. The method comprises: if there is no interface between a first base station and a second base station, the first base station determines a corresponding core network and a corresponding interface; if the corresponding core network is a first core network corresponding to the first base station, the first base station sends first measurement configuration information to a control plane entity of the first core network; the control plane entity of the first core network sends the first measurement configuration information to a control plane entity of a second core network; the control plane entity of the second core network sends the first measurement configuration information to the second base station; and the second base station determines inter-system measurement configuration information of a terminal within the coverage of the second base station for the first base station.
